Rush is a New Zealand television channel owned and operated by Sky Network Television, which acquired it from Warner Bros. Discovery. It is broadcast via Sky, the state-owned Kordia transmission network, Sky and the streaming platform ThreeNow. The channel launched on 21 March 2022. Rush focuses on adventure shows such as Man vs Wild, Manhunt With Joel Lambert, Deadliest Catch and Treehouse Masters. The channel shares its name and some of its programming with Australian TV channel 9Rush.
